1. Bvlgari Spa London – Adeela Crown “Skin Suite”
Choose a week of concentrated focus with this residency-style facial, led by celebrated aesthetic specialist Adeela Crown. The “Skin Suite” format offers one-on-one precision: expect sculpting massages, advanced device use, and bespoke product routines. Pair your appointment with a stay in the hotel’s top suite – private check-in, spa butler, and a post-treatment lounge in the Members’ Club. For someone seeking that pre-Christmas glow without sacrificing time for travel, this London location unites convenience and discretion.
2. ESPA Life at Corinthia London – Festive Spa Experience with Augustinus Bader
This seasonal offering pairs a high-performance facial (powered by Augustinus Bader’s TFC8 formula) with access to the hotel’s thermal floor and pool. After your facial, imagine slipping into saltwater pools, steam cabins, and a quiet lounge with a winter cocktail. It’s the kind of experience where the skin is treated and the moment lingers – ideal for a stay-over before the calendar gets busy. Book a junior suite and make your spa day part of a mini luxury retreat.
3. La Prairie at The Ritz-Carlton New York, Central Park – Platinum Rare / Pure Gold / White Caviar

In Manhattan’s heart, this Swiss skincare institution elevates the facial into an event. Select from their Platinum Rare firming, Pure Gold luminosity, or White Caviar tone-refinement protocols. The surrounding hotel complements the treatment beautifully: after your facial, linger in a Park-facing suite, take in the city lights from a window seat, and enjoy room service or a late-night cocktail. For an urban escape just before the holidays, this delivers statement skin and setting.
4. Le Meurice, Paris – Spa Valmont “Vitality of the Glaciers”
French elegance meets high-performance skincare with the Vitality of the Glaciers ritual, now enhanced with a collagen component. The facial uses Valmont’s glacier water, precise massage, and advanced mask treatments to reset skin fatigued by winter air or travel. At Le Meurice, you’re immersed in Parisian style: book a suite that overlooks the Tuileries and allow your spa appointment to dovetail with drinks at the hotel’s bar – bridging the treatment with a full evening of refinement.
5. Dior Spa at Hôtel Plaza Athénée, Paris – Le Soin Dior Privé (Bespoke)
When the occasion calls for something unique, this bespoke facial delivers. A diagnostic consultation identifies your skin’s precise needs, then the therapist carefully curates a sequence – whether electro-modulation, cryotherapy, or precision botanical layering. A package stay in the hotel’s Eiffel-Tower-view suite adds the perfect complement: breakfast in bed, in-suite spa amenities, and an early morning rendezvous with the treatment room. Ideal for travellers combining beauty with a luxury hotel narrative.
6. Regent Santa Monica – Guerlain “Imperial Longevity Facial”

For those seeking light, restorative luxury by the sea, this ocean-adjacent spa offers the Guerlain ritual dedicated to regeneration and luminosity. The results can also be enhanced through LED therapy or microdermabrasion. After the facial, wander to the hotel’s terrace, watch the Pacific dusk, and savour a healthy seasonal meal in the members’ lounge. A stay here transforms the facial from a session into a seaside luxury ritual – perfect for arriving ahead of the festive flurry and letting the calm set in.
7. Four Seasons Hotel George V, Paris – “George V Escape by Dr Burgener”
A luxe layering of experience: your facial is part of the “Escape” programme, featuring antioxidant-rich facials with gold, Chardonnay grape and green caviar. The setting is in one of Paris’s most luxurious hotels, with suites that offer private terraces, Champagne at sunset, and in-suite yoga if desired. The spa day thus becomes a destination unto itself – book the facial mid-stay to arrive at your Christmas gatherings looking luminous, rested, and decidedly elegant.
8. Rosewood Hotel Georgia, Vancouver – Sense® Spa Festive Facial Offer
While geographically distant from the traditional European hub, this Vancouver-based indulgence caters superbly to jet-lagged or long-haul travellers. A full facial with a bonus foot hot-stone massage and mask is tailor-made for a pre-holiday refresh. Stay in a heritage suite, use the private screening lounge or rooftop deck, and let the spa service be the anchor of your luxury hotel stay. If your December includes a trans-Pacific leg, this facial sits neatly into your travel rhythm.
